How long is the flight to Gold Coast?

An average direct flight from Malaysia to Gold Coast takes 21h 02m, covering a distance of 10205 km. The shortest route is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port (KUL) to Coolangatta (OOL) with an average flight time of 13h 45m.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Malaysia to Gold Coast?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Malaysia to Gold Coast with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est day to fly to Gold Coast?

    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Gold Coast is Monday when return tickets can be as cheap as RM 3,350.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Thursday, when return prices are RM 4,340 on average.
